Transaction afa6ce15e505b7c9a72bf51253d6579ec56682fb4c27ce6e5d886f056308da24

43 Input
2 Outputs
  • afa6ce15e505b7c9a72bf51253d6579ec56682fb4c27ce6e5d886f056308da24:0
  • value  500000000
    address  399ovDLkWB46Uuf21TLq94wQ9bD4sBxHGr
  • afa6ce15e505b7c9a72bf51253d6579ec56682fb4c27ce6e5d886f056308da24:1
  • value  866977
    address  35btQoizJ6AB3pWSb1D1A4D9ACSTsnNBC2